Adress: Independenţei street 1 GPS: 47.06012 N, 21.93794 E Oradea, Church of the Order of Mercy, Miseri church or Guardian Angel churchThese three names refer to a small XVIIIth century church, the building of which started around 1754.Craftsmen working on the Cathedral also took part in it. The painting on the elliptic dome, which is rather rare in Transylvania, was made by I. A. Rupp in 1869. The wood-carvings are also magnificent. The group of statues over the main altar represents the Holy Trinity. On the pulpit one can see the symbols representing the four evangelists. A winged lad represents Saint Matthew, an ox head stands for Saint Lukas, a lion head for Saint Mark and an eagle with spread wings represents Saint John. There are also many large wood statues, which used to be on the basilica's main altar. They got here after the marble altar was erected in the basilica. The name of the artist who made these remarkably well carved wood statues is unknown. In the vault they buried noblemen, but the founder of the church, György Gyöngyösi, is also buried here. It was him who built the order's house, the hospital and the apothecary, which still function today.
The church is closed from November till April. Mass is held on the first Saturday of the other months. On October the 2nd, Guardian Angel saint's-day is held.
